  2. Dictionary

    num·ber
    [ˈnəmbər]
    noun
    number (noun) · numbers (plural noun)
    1. an arithmetical value, expressed by a word, symbol, or figure, representing a particular quantity and used in counting and making calculations and for showing order in a series or for identification:
      "she dialed the number carefully" · "an even number"
      • dated
        (numbers)
        arithmetic:
        "the boy was adept at numbers"
    2. a quantity or amount:
      "the company is seeking to increase the number of women on its staff" · "the exhibition attracted vast numbers of visitors"
    3. BRITISH ENGLISH
      a single issue of a magazine:
      "the October number of “Travel.”"
    4. a distinction of word form denoting reference to one person or thing or to more than one. See also singular, plural, count noun, and mass noun.
      "the form of English pronouns reflects their number and gender"
    verb
    number (verb) · numbers (third person present) · numbered (past tense) · numbered (past participle) · numbering (present participle)
    1. amount to (a specified figure or quantity); comprise:
      "the demonstrators numbered more than 5,000"
      Similar:
      amount to
    2. mark with a number or assign a number to, typically to indicate position in a series:
      "each document was numbered consecutively"
      Similar:
      assign a number to
      categorize by number
      specify by number
      mark with a number
    3. include or classify as a member of a group:
      "the orchestra numbers Brahms among its past conductors"
    Origin
    Middle English: from Old French nombre (noun), nombrer (verb), from Latin numerus.

    What is the purpose of a number? A number is a basic component of mathematics. Numbers are used for counting, measuring, keeping things in order, indexing, etc. We have different types of numbers based on their properties such as natural numbers, whole numbers, rational and irrational numbers, integers, real numbers, complex numbers, even and odd numbers, etc.
    What is the definition of number?A number is an arithmetic value used for representing the quantity and used in making calculations. A written symbol like “3” which represents a number is known as numerals. A number system is a writing system for denoting numbers using digits or symbols in a logical manner.
